For many petite bodies, wide-leg jeans can feel like a fashion paradox: roomy through the legs yet potentially overpowering at the top and bottom. The key is balancing volume with proportion. Start by choosing a mid-rise or high-rise waist that cinches above the natural waist, creating an elongated torso and preventing the jeans from sliding down and bunching. Look for a leg that starts to flare just below the hip rather than at the widest part of the thigh, which preserves vertical lines. Fabric weight matters; a medium to slightly heavier denim holds shape without collapsing into puddles. When trying on, walk, sit, and bend to ensure movement remains graceful.
The silhouette you want is one that adds length without sacrificing comfort or movement. Petite frames benefit from a clean, uninterrupted vertical line. To achieve this, opt for wide legs with a slightly cropped length that ends just above the ankle, which helps reveal a flattering shoe and visually extends the leg. Choose a darker wash with subtle contrast stitching to slim the lower half and maintain leg integrity. Avoid heavy embellishments near the pockets or hems, which can draw the eye outward and disrupt the line. Accessories and footwear should anchor the look, not overwhelm it.
Hem length and shoe pairing to lengthen the line.
Start with a tailored fit at the waist and hips; the goal is to prevent billowing fabric that swallows the frame. Look for wide-leg cuts that taper gradually from the knee to the hem; this strategy preserves a long, continuous line from waist through toe. If your thighs are fuller, consider a high-rise style that sits firmly above the widest part of the hip to reduce pull and strain at the front. Seam placement matters: a clean rise without conspicuous horizontal seams helps maintain leg length. In the dressing-room, rotate your stance and test different motions to confirm the fabric drapes rather than clings.

The choice of hem is crucial to scale and proportion. A precise hem that just skimps the top of the shoe creates the illusion of longer legs, especially when you pair nude or tonal footwear. For petites, a slightly shorter inseam—often around 28 to 30 inches depending on height—tends to work better than a full-length break. If you prefer a longer line, select a cropped pair that ends mid-ankle and finish with a shoe that has a pointed or sleek silhouette. The point is to maintain a consistent vertical rhythm; anything that disrupts that rhythm will shorten the perceived leg.
Clean lines, minimal detailing, and smart layering basics.
Fabric choice sets the foundation for a flattering, clean silhouette. Lightweight denim with a touch of stretch can move with you, but avoid fabrics that sag or stretch too much after a day’s wear. A stiffer, non-stretch denim tends to hold the wide-leg shape longer, which can be advantageous for petites seeking a crisp line. Darker colors create length and minimize bulk, while a matte finish reduces glare that can draw attention to the midsection. Be mindful of pocket placement; off-center or larger pockets can visually widen the hip area. Minimal branding and simple, neutral hardware keep the eye along the vertical axis.

Consider alternates to the classic five-pocket design to refine the silhouette. A pair with a darted back pocket or no back pockets at all can reduce visual width at the seat, creating a smoother contour. If you love color or a statement wash, keep it limited to one piece of detail and maintain the rest of the outfit in complementary neutrals. The goal is to avoid competing focal points that interrupt the line from waist to ankle. Try pairing your jeans with tucked-in tops, slim knits, or structured blouses to emphasize elongation and balance. Layering with a blazer can further emphasize vertical proportion.
Footwear and top balance to optimize leg-length illusion.
The way you style the upper body drastically influences how wide-leg jeans read on a petite frame. Start with a fitted or semi-fitted top that stays near the waist or hip, avoiding bulky knits that add visual mass. A tucked-in blouse, a crisp button-down, or a sleek bodysuit can anchor the look and anchor attention to the elongation of the leg. Choose a belt sparingly; if you wear one, pick a slim, tonal belt that doesn’t compete with the line of the jeans. The goal is a cohesive, tall silhouette where the eye travels naturally from waist to ankle without interruption.
Footwear selection is a decisive finishing move for proportion. Pointed-toe flats or low to mid-heel sandals can dramatically extend the leg line when paired with cropped or ankle-length wide-legs. For days when you want more height, a modest heel in a nude or skin-tone shade minimizes breaks in the line. Avoid chunky platform shoes that interrupt the vertical flow; instead, favor sleek, streamlined footwear. If you’re wearing a longer top, keep the hemline and silhouette balanced so the shoe remains visible and the leg looks continuous. The right shoe choice can transform a good fit into a flawless, leg-lengthening effect.

Practice, adjust, and refine your proportion-friendly wardrobe.
For some petites, tailoring may be the most reliable ally. Off-the-rack wide-leg jeans can sometimes require a quick alteration to achieve perfect proportion. A professional tailor can shorten the inseam slightly without shrinking the leg opening, adjust the waist to sit perfectly at the natural waist, and refine pockets if necessary. Small alterations can produce dramatic results, turning a generic fit into a custom-like silhouette. Don’t fear minor adjustments; they are a practical step toward achieving a taller, leaner appearance. After alterations, recheck the overall balance with the same tried-on outfits to ensure continued harmony.
